UPDATE 3-Starbucks to enter India within two years
* Starbucks repeats plan to enter India within two years (Adds background and share activity)
LOS ANGELES, July 24 (Reuters) - Coffee chain Starbucks Corp (SBUX.O) plans to enter India within two years, a spokeswoman said on Friday.
The Seattle-based company, however, has not started selecting cafe sites or setting up a local unit, spokeswoman May Kulthol told Reuters.
The company had previously said it planned to enter India within two years, Kulthol said.
The Japanese business daily Nikkei reported earlier on Friday that Starbucks had already started selecting cafe sites and setting up a local unit. That report cited an interview with Starbucks Chief Financial Officer Troy Alstead.
India has a growing middle class and many U.S. companies are targeting it for international growth.
Starbucks shares were trading down 13 cents, or less than 1 percent, at $17.13 in midday trade on the Nasdaq. (Reporting by Lisa Baertlein, editing by Gerald E. McCormick)
